Ramon G. Songco is a partner at SyCip Salazar Hernandez & Gatmaitan in the Philippines. He specialises in litigation and arbitration (civil, commercial, criminal and administrative), including contract disputes, tax and local taxation matters, environmental (writ of kalikasan) cases, estate proceedings, international commercial and sports arbitration, and general corporate law.

Education
- A.B. Economics, La Salle College (now University of St. La Salle), Bacolod City, 1985
- B.S.C. Marketing Management, La Salle College (now University of St. La Salle), Bacolod City, 1985
- Bachelor of Laws, Ateneo de Manila University, 1990 (Second Honors; ranked third in class)
Admissions
- Passed the 1990 Bar Examinations (Philippines) — placed 5th among successful examinees
